Aminoglycosides are a structurally diverse family of aminosugar and aminocyclitol derivatives that are currently the only well-characterized class of small molecules that selectively bind RNA, [1] including sites on prokaryotic 16S rRNA which is believed to be the locus of aminogylcoside antibiotic
